HOLLYWOOD - Analysts were continuing to express amazement over the fact that the

highest-rated entertainment programs during the November sweeps were CBS

specials featuring Carol Burnett, Michael Jackson and Lucille Ball.

Washington Post TV critic Tom Shales commented in his column

today: "Let us now hug Carol Burnett. ... [Her ratings victory]

sends a message to the networks that Americans are craving family

programming once again. Sept. 11 casts a long shadow, and its effects

will be felt for years to come. One of those effects is to make people

hungry for TV programming that is familiar, reassuring, cozy, pleasant

and positive."

Nevertheless, CBS president Les Moonves told Reuters

Thursday: "Those who want to claim this was just a specials win are

totally inaccurate. ... The bedrock of our success is the incredible

depth of our core series."
